Everything that has been said so far I totally agree with, but without repeating here are my top 3.
1. fl.getDocumentDOM() - able to retrieve script files. ie; .as, .asc, .jsfl and then being able to navigate to a specific line number
2. Object oriented would be awesome, because I reuse a lot of my code but there really isn't a nice and clean way to do it currently.
3. Being able to pass full objects back with MMExecute
Bonus feature - being able to execute applications or files. currently we can use Guy's FileSystem.dll for PC but being able to do it on a MAC would be great.

Hello:
I've noted some interest in submitting "JSFL Wish-List" feedback to Macromedia, along with some confusion about where to post such remarks. Well, as one of the Flash QA Engineers working with JSFL, I'd say the best place to send them is to this list, and the best time is now. Although personally I have not more than a teenie-weenie influence re: what gets added or improved upon, [no sarcasm, it's really about thisbig ] I can bend the ear of those with more influence, but users have by far the loudest voice. [ ie: FLfile came from ur requests. ] With this in mind, Macromedia periodically asks for the "top 3 things u would like to do with JSFL which currently are not possible." [because of bugs or functionality which just isn't currently implemented].
So here it is: the First Official Request for "Flash 9" (btw, name TBD) re JSFL:
Please list the top 3 things u would like to do with JSFL which currently are not possible, or are possible, just not gracefully.
